# Poll Widget

## Objective

Ask a one-question poll anywhere in the app and show the results as soon as someone votes.

An embeddable single-question poll with a vote control and a results view revealed after voting.

## Implementation Instructions

1. Keep it to one question with a small set of options. The moment it grows a second question it is a survey and belongs in the survey feature instead.
2. Record the vote on the server and return the updated tallies in the same response, so the results the voter sees are the real counts rather than an optimistic local guess that may disagree after a refresh.
3. Hold voting open to signed-out visitors if the poll is public, and identify them well enough to prevent casual repeat voting without demanding an account for a single click.
4. Show the total response count next to the percentages. A split of sixty and forty means something very different across ten votes and ten thousand.
5. Do not let a vote be silently changeable. Either allow a vote to be changed and say so plainly with the previous choice shown, or lock it after submission, but do not let a second click quietly move the count.

## Edge Cases

- Preventing repeat votes without an account means combining signals such as a persistent cookie and coarse network identification, and accepting that neither is authoritative. Apply the app's existing Rate Limiting per poll so a determined script cannot flood the tallies.
- A poll can close between the moment the page rendered and the moment the vote arrives. Reject the late vote on the server, tell the voter the poll has closed, and show them the final results rather than pretending the vote counted.
- Showing the current results before someone votes anchors their answer toward the leading option. Keep results hidden until a vote is cast or the poll closes, and make that behaviour visible so it does not read as a bug.
- Rounded percentages frequently sum to ninety-nine or a hundred and one. Use a rounding approach that forces the displayed figures to total one hundred, and show raw counts alongside so the arithmetic can be checked.
- Adding an option after voting has started makes earlier results incomparable, because nobody who voted first was offered the new choice. Either forbid it once the first vote lands, or record when each option was added and mark the results as affected.
- A poll with zero votes must render its options and an honest empty state, not percentages derived from a division by zero.
- Results are usually drawn as bars. Give every option its percentage and count as text so the outcome is readable without seeing the bars, and do not rely on colour alone to mark the option the viewer chose.
- A poll is written by one person and rendered to everyone who loads the page, which makes the question and its options a publishing surface rather than a form input. Screen them when the poll is saved and escape them when it renders, or an embedded poll becomes a way to put arbitrary markup in front of every visitor.
